From dc295ab22774916261ecb8d611da4ee694a18b28 Mon Sep 17 00:00:00 2001 From: Tyler Goodlet Date: Sun, 9 Oct 2022 13:03:52 -0400 Subject: [PATCH] Pin pre-0.22 bc exception groups break everything --- setup.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/setup.py b/setup.py index f27a20d..7a46d98 100755 --- a/setup.py +++ b/setup.py @@ -43,7 +43,9 @@ setup( install_requires=[ # trio related - 'trio >= 0.20', + # proper range spec: + # https://packaging.python.org/en/latest/discussions/install-requires-vs-requirements/#id5 + 'trio >= 0.20, < 0.22', 'async_generator', 'trio_typing',